مقالات عملية مرتبة حسب المجال والمستوى، اختر المجال المناسب واقرأ من مستوى مبتدئ إلى محترف.
Prompt Injection هي الثغرة رقم 1 في OWASP للذكاء الاصطناعي في 2026. مقال للمبتدئ بمثال السكرتير اللي بينخدع، أرقام حقيقية (73% من النشر الإنتاجي مصاب)، حالة تحويلات بنكية احتيالية بـ 250 ألف دولار، 4 طبقات دفاع تخفّض النجاح من 73.2% لـ 8.7%، وكود Python شغّال على Claude Sonnet 4.6.
لو نفس الـ system prompt بيتبعت مع كل استدعاء لـ Claude، انت بتدفع تمنه من الأول كل مرة. Prompt Caching بيخفّض تكلفة الجزء المتكرّر بنسبة 90% بسطر واحد، مع شرح للمبتدئ بمثال أمين المخزن، تعريف علمي من توثيق Anthropic الرسمي، كود Python في 14 سطر، أرقام حقيقية على Claude Sonnet 4.6، 4 trade-offs خفية، ومتى الـ caching بيكون مضيعة وقت.
Model Context Protocol بقى المعيار الفعلي لتوصيل الأدوات بنماذج LLM في 2026. مقال للمتوسط بمثال USB-C للأجهزة، تعريف علمي مبني على spec الـ JSON-RPC، خطوات عملية لربط Zendesk + PostgreSQL + GitHub، أرقام مقاسة على 1,800 تذكرة دعم عربية (وقت المعالجة من 14 دقيقة لـ 3.4 دقيقة)، 4 trade-offs خفية، ومتى MCP بيكون مبالغة هندسية.
لو خدمة في الإنتاج بقت بطيئة فجأة وفريقك بيقول "محتاجين نضيف tracing"، ده معناه أسبوع شغل وزيادة 8% latency على الـ hot path. eBPF و bpftrace بيدّوك نفس الإجابات في 4 سطور shell بدون restart وبدون deploy. مقال للمحترف مع مثال PostgreSQL مقاس على إنتاج بـ 14K req/s، شرح علمي للـ verifier من kernel docs، 4 trade-offs خفية، ومتى eBPF يكون الاختيار الغلط.
لو زرار dashboard بياخد 320ms قبل ما يستجيب، الموقع مش بطيء — هو شغّال long task بيقفل main thread. scheduler.yield في Chrome 129 بتنزّل INP لـ 80ms بدون Web Worker، وبتحفظ ترتيبك في Search لأن INP بقى رسمي في Core Web Vitals من مارس 2024.
لو سيرفر PostgreSQL بياكل 1.8 جيجا رام وبيرجّع too many clients عند 200 مستخدم، المشكلة مش في حجم السيرفر، المشكلة في غياب طبقة pooling. مقال للمبتدئ بمثال الأسانسير المشترك، شرح علمي لـ Connection Pool، إعداد PgBouncer كامل في 10 سطور، أرقام مقاسة من إنتاج (الذاكرة من 1.4GB لـ 280MB، 0 أخطاء في 90 يوم)، 4 trade-offs خفية، ومتى PgBouncer مش الحل أصلًا.
لو function بتاعتك بتاخد ثانيتين على 1000 سجل وبتاخد 4 ساعات على مليون، المشكلة مش في الـ CPU. مقال للمبتدئ بمثال دفتر التليفونات، تعريف علمي من Donald Knuth (TAOCP 1968) و CLRS الفصل 3، كود JavaScript شغّال على Node.js 22 يقارن O(n²) ضد O(n) على مليون عنصر (4.8 ثانية مقابل 38 مللي ثانية، تحسّن 126×)، شرح للأنواع الستة الشائعة، 4 trade-offs حقيقية، ومتى Big O بتخدعك أو ميستاهلش تهتم بيها.
لو فريقك لسه بيـ kubectl apply يدوي أو بيشغّل deploy.sh من CI بصلاحيات admin، حالة الإنتاج مش متطابقة مع git. مقال للمتوسط بمثال محل تأجير الدراجات للمبتدئ، تعريف علمي من OpenGitOps Working Group 2023، 4 خطوات تركيب ArgoCD v2.13 على EKS 1.30 بكود YAML شغّال، أرقام مقاسة من فريق 8 مهندسين على 24 microservice (rollback من 14 دقيقة لـ 38 ثانية، 47 drift اتمسح تلقائياً)، 4 trade-offs خفية، ومتى GitOps يكون مبالغة هندسية.
لو الطلب في تطبيقك بيمر على 14 microservice وفجأة P95 طلع من 280ms لـ 3.2 ثانية، الـ logs مش هتقولك المشكلة فين. مقال للمتوسط بمثال محقق الشرطة للمبتدئ، تعريف علمي من توثيق OpenTelemetry الرسمي و ورقة Google Dapper 2010، كود FastAPI شغّال على opentelemetry-distro 0.48، أرقام مقاسة من e-commerce بـ 22,000 طلب checkout/يوم (وقت التشخيص من 47 دقيقة لـ 2.3 دقيقة)، 4 trade-offs خفية، ومتى OTel مبالغة هندسية.